TÜBİTAK left its mark on Turkey's science and technology scene with a tremendous participation in TEKNOFEST Izmir. Bringing innovation and technology together, TEKNOFEST Izmir brought an unforgettable energy.
Organized at Çiğli Airport, the five-day festival welcomed thousands of curious visitors in the fields of aviation, space and technology.

Among the events organized at the TÜBİTAK MAM stand at the festival:
Application of Different Materials under the Microscope: This activity, which involved the detailed examination of various materials and different tissue cells under the microscope, offered visitors the opportunity to discover the mysteries of the microscopic world.
Yogurt Bacteria and Some Molds Isolated from Foods Under the Microscope: The study of yogurt bacteria and molds isolated from foods under the microscope aimed to raise awareness about the world of microorganisms.
Experiments with Liquid Nitrogen and Potassium Chlorate - Sugar Reaction: This activity, which demonstrated the unusual properties of liquid nitrogen, gave participants the chance to experience interesting aspects of chemistry. Experimentally demonstrating the reactions of sugar in the body and explaining the various disorders caused by excess sugar in the body, this experiment allowed us to see the consequences of many of our habits.
Hydrogen Value Chain Demonstration: Awareness raising activities were carried out on sustainable energy production, green hydrogen production and carbon footprint reduction.
Noise Barrier: Aiming to explore ways to reduce the impact of environmental noise on people in cities, this event aimed to raise awareness on noise management.
Polar Mascots (Albatross, Whale, Polar Bear, Penguin): Providing information about the unique ecosystems of the polar regions through different polar mascots, this activity aimed to raise environmental awareness.
Carbon Footprint Measurement: This activity aimed to raise awareness about the impact of human activities on climate change by measuring individuals' carbon footprints.
CO2 Sources and Sinks: It was aimed to raise awareness about climate change by observing the sources and sinks that cause carbon dioxide, an important greenhouse gas, to accumulate in the atmosphere through the experimental setup.
In addition to the exciting TÜBİTAK MAM events, expert researchers presented "Hydrogen Technologies and Green Transformation", "Climate Change and Cities" in the fields of Environment, Energy and Climate Technologies, "Innovative Food Technologies for Healthy and Quality Life", "The Importance and Future of Biotechnological Pharmaceuticals" in the fields of Health and Wellness Technologies. The presentations provided visitors with the opportunity to understand the latest developments in the sector and predict future technological innovations.
